I've had the disease twice (once for 4 yrs.), & my son had it twice many years before I did. He developed it the first in l979 -- when no one (including most docs.) knew about it. He was the youngest & l of the 1st people on oral Vancocin. Prior to that time, it was strictly an IV medication.
